技术栈
手写vuex
BNTang
1 年前
手写vuex
手撕Vuex-安装模块方法
经过上一篇文章的介绍,我们实现了将模块安装到 store 中,那么本章我们就来介绍一下怎么安装模块当中的方法也就是 actions、mutations、getters。
BNTang
1 年前
手写vuex
手撕Vuex-安装模块数据
根据上一篇,【手写Vuex】-提取模块信息,我们已经可以获取到模块的信息了,将模块信息变成了我们想要的数据结构,接下来我们就要根据模块的信息,来安装模块的数据。
BNTang
1 年前
手写vuex
手撕Vuex-提取模块信息
在上一篇【手撕Vuex-模块化共享数据】文章中,已经了解了模块化,与共享数据的注意点。那么接下来就要在我们自己的 Nuex 中实现共享数据模块化的功能。那么怎么在我们自己的 Nuex 中实现共享数据模块化的功能呢?
BNTang
1 年前
手写vuex
手撕Vuex-模块化共享数据下
好,经过上一篇的介绍,了解了 Vuex 当中的模块化,本章主要介绍 Vuex 当中的模块化共享数据下篇。
BNTang
1 年前
手写vuex
手撕Vuex-模块化共享数据上
好,经过上一篇的介绍,实现了 Vuex 当中的 actions 方法,接下来我们来实现 Vuex 当中的模块化共享数据(modules)。
BNTang
1 年前
手写vuex
手撕Vuex-实现actions方法
经过上一篇章介绍,完成了实现 mutations 的功能,那么接下来本篇将会实现 actions 的功能。
BNTang
1 年前
手写vuex
手撕Vuex-实现mutations方法
经过上一篇章介绍,完成了实现 getters 的功能,那么接下来本篇将会实现 mutations 的功能。
BNTang
1 年前
手写vuex
手撕Vuex-Vuex实现原理分析
本章节主要围绕着手撕 Vuex,那么在手撕之前,先来回顾一下 Vuex 的基本使用。创建一个 Vuex 项目,我这里采用 vue-cli 创建一个项目,然后安装 Vuex。